QUESTION: What do you get when you subtract the Major Scale from the Chromatic Scale?
PROCEDURE: The C Major Scale contains the notes C, D, E, F, G, A, B. The Chromatic scale contains all of these, plus C#, D#, F#, G#, A#. Those notes make up the F# Major Pentatonic Scale.
ANSWER: the Chromatic Scale minus any chosen Major Scale results in the Major Pentatonic Scale whose root is a tritone away from the root of the chosen Major Scale.

Root 2 connections
The brainfart on page 47 of my book "Chaos In Boxes" describes a hairy scenario involving the Square Root of 2; it was the first irrational number to be discovered by Hippasus* and resulted in his assassination by his fellow Pythagoreans, who believed all numbers to be expressible as the ratio of two integers!
(This came about during the Chapter "Quincunx And The Legend Of The Chromatic Transformation Matrix Starflower", wherein I was inspired to compare a semitone to a fifth.)
Since then, I've noticed a few connections concerning Root 2.
A musical interval between two notes can be described by dividing their frequencies; it so happens that Root 2 (which equals 1.414213...) is exactly the ratio for the infamous Tritone in Equal Temperament. This seems somehow suitable or ironic, considering that:
a) the Tritone was once condemned as "evil" by some religions - echoing in my mind the Pythagorean's rejection of Hippasus
b) the Tritone ultimately holds the key to undeniably powerful harmony through the resolution of a dominant chord towards its parent tonic chord - echoing in my mind the importance of Hippasus' discovery of irrational numbers

After all, a very common technique in jazz is Tritone substitution, a.k.a. the "Sub V". This is based on the fact that a dominant 7th chord is extremely similar to the same type of chord a Tritone away, sharing most of the same tones.
Just today I learned that ISO paper sizes (A0, A1, A2, A3, A4, etc.) all have an aspect of Root 2! (The big advantage of this proportion is that you can cut or fold such a rectangle in half and it will still have the same aspect ratio, enabling scaling without cutoffs or margins.)
